The hexadecimal color code(color number) for PANTONE 5463 C is #07272D, and the RGB color code is RGB(7, 39, 45).
In the RGB color model, PANTONE 5463 C has a red value of 7, a green value of 39, and a blue value of 45.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 84.4%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 82.4%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 189.5° (degrees), 73.1 % saturation, and 10.2 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, PANTONE 5463 C has a hue of 189.5° (degrees), 84.4 % saturation and 17.6 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of PANTONE 5463 C?
PANTONE 5463 C has an LRV of nearly 2. By LRV value, it is a very d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.
